There is a popular belief among parents that schools are no longer interested in spelling. No school I have taught in has ever
ignored spelling or considered it unimportant as a basic skill. There are, however, vastly different ideas about how to teach it, or how
much priority it must be given over general language development and writing ability. The problem is, how to encourage a child to
express himself freely and confidently in writing without holding him back with the complexities of spelling?

A breakthrough in the provision of energy from the sun for the European Economic Community could be brought forward by
up to two decades, if a modest increase could be provided in the EECs research effort in this field, according to the senior EEC scientists
engaged in experiments in solar energy at EECs scientific laboratories at Ispra near Milan.

The senior West German scientist in charge of the Communitys solar energy program, Mr. Joachim Gretz, told journalists that at
present levels of research spending it was most unlikely that solar energy would provide as much as three percent of the Communitys energy
requirements even after the year 2,000. But he said that with a modest increase in the present sums, devoted by the EEC to this work it was
possible that the breakthrough could be achieved by the end of the next decade.

Mr. Gretz calculates that if solar energy only provided three percent of the EECs needs, this could still produce a saving of about
a billion pounds in the present bill for imported energy each year. And he believes that with the possibility of utilizing more advanced
technology in this field it might be possible to satisfy a much bigger share of the Communitys future energy needs.

At present the EEC spends about $2.6 millions a year on solar research at Ispra, one of the EECs official joint research centres,
and another $3 millions a year in indirect research with universities and other independent bodies.
